Management-Leadership Practices Inventory (MLPI)
User Level: C

Management-Leadership Practices Inventory (MLPI) is a norm-based 360°-feedback instrument that assesses a supervisor’s management and leadership skills. Taking less than 15 minutes to complete, the participant is rated on 85 behavioral descriptors using a seven-point scale. The MLPI is based on ratings of skills rather than personality characteristics and permits self-ratings in addition to those of employees, peers, and supervisors. A comprehensive report is generated for feedback to the manager.

The MLPI is an instrument well-suited for executive coaching, individual development assessments, and training. It also can be used to identify training needs as well as an outcome measure after training. Additionally, composite results of MLPI scores can be summarized by work unit, function, and organizational level in order to provide feedback in organizational change projects.

What The MLPI Measures

The MLPI provides objective feedback about a manager’s behavior on twenty key factors that are grouped into three categories:

Management Practices
Planning Technical Expertise
Performance Standards Coaching
Evaluating Performance Facilitating Change
Delegation Recognition
Goal Setting

Interpersonal Style

Directive

Participative
Approachable
Leadership Practices
Communication Strategy
Empowering Employees Teamwork
Resourcefulness Trust
Decisiveness Self-Confidence

The MLPI Report

The MLPI report is comprised of five sections and provides the subject with extensive feedback.
Overview provides a quick summary of the MLPI Factor scores.
Percentile Graph plots each MLPI Factor scores compared to the normative sample.
Item Responses lists all items by MLPI Factor.
Statistical Table shows the supervisor’s average scores (and standard deviation) on each MLPI Factor.
High/Low Summary Report lists the highest and lowest MLPI Factors determined by percentile scores.
